NISSAN PATHFINDER HYBRID 2014 R52 / 4.G Dismantling Guide •The colors of the high voltage harnesses and connectors are all orange. Orange�High
Voltage �labels are applied to the Li-ion battery and other high voltage devices. Do not
touch the Li-ion battery
